Family Lawyers Savor Murder Ruling
OAKLAND - Family law attorneys and advocates for victims of domestic abuse are cheering a recent decision by a state appeals court that holds the city of Oakland liable for the murder of a woman by an ex-boyfriend whom police failed to detain even though he violated a restraining order.
